Why Hire a Professional Patio Door Installer?
Installing patio doors can be a complex endeavor that requires specialized skills and experience. Here are some reasons that working with a professional installer is advisable:

Expertise: Professional installers are knowledgeable about various kinds of patio doors, their elements, and the installation processes specific to each door type.

Time Efficiency: An experienced installer can complete the job faster than a DIY approach, saving homeowners valuable time.

Quality Assurance: Professionals make sure that the installation fulfills local structure codes and standards, which can avoid future concerns.

Service warranty Protection: Many producers require professional installation to validate guarantees. Employing a professional helps protect your financial investment.

What to Expect During the Patio Door Installation Process
Having a clear understanding of the installation process can alleviate issues and set appropriate expectations. Below is a common summary of what house owners can anticipate:
Step-by-Step Installation Process
Initial Consultation:
Discuss door options, designs, and materials.Finalize design and acquire a clear estimate.
Preparation:
Preparation of the installation site, including removing the old door.Ensuring the area is tidy and devoid of blockages.
Measurement and Fit:
Accurate measurements to make sure the new Door Installation Cost fits perfectly.Making needed adjustments before installation.
Installation:
Properly setting up the door frame and Door Contractor unit.Securing the door and ensuring it operates smoothly.
Sealing and Insulating:
Applying weatherproofing to improve energy effectiveness.Sealing any gaps to prevent drafts.
Last Inspection:

A1: The installation of a patio door typically takes anywhere from a couple of hours to a full day, depending upon the door type and any necessary repairs to the surrounding structure.
Q2: Can I set up a patio door myself?
A2: While some house owners select to set up patio doors on their own, it is usually suggested to employ a professional to make sure a correct fit and meet building regulations.
Q3: What are the signs that I require a new patio door?
A3: Common signs consist of difficulty opening or closing the door, drafts, condensation between glass panes, or visible damages like fractures or warping.
